WHAT ARE COOKIES?

Cookies and other similar technologies such as local shared objects, flash cookies or pixels, are tools

used by Web servers to store and retrieve information about their visitors, as well as to enable the

proper functioning of the site.

Through using these devices, the Web server is able to remember some data concerning the user,

such as their preferences for viewing the server’s pages, their name and password, products that

interest them most, etc.

 

COOKIES AFFECTED BY, AND COOKIES EXEMPT FROM REGULATIONS

According to the EU directive, the cookies that require the user’s informed consent are analysis,

advertising and affiliation cookies, while technical cookies and those that are necessary for the

operation of the website or the provision of services expressly requested by the user are exempt.

 

TYPES OF COOKIES

DEPENDING ON THE PURPOSE

Technical and functional cookies: allow the user to navigate through a website, platform or

application and the use of different options or services available in it.

 

Analysis cookies: allow the controller to monitor and analyse the behaviour of the users of

the websites they are linked to. The information collected by this type of cookie is used to

measure the activity of the websites, application or platform and to carry out browsing profiling

of the users of said sites, applications and platforms, with the purpose of introducing

improvements in the analysis of the user data carried out by service users.

 

Advertising cookies: allow management, in the most efficient way possible, of advertising

spaces which, if applicable, the editor has included in a website, application or platform from

where requested service is provided based on data such as the edited content or frequency

with which advertisements are made.

 

Behavioural advertising cookies: collect information on the user’s personal preferences and

choices (retargeting) in order to allow management, in the most efficient way possible, of the

Social cookies: established by the social network platforms in the services to allow content to

be shared with friends and networks. The social media platforms have the ability to track

activity online outside the Services. This may affect the content and messages seen in other

services used.

 

Affiliate cookies: allow you to track visits through links from other websites, with which the website establishes affiliate agreements (affiliate companies).

 

Security cookies: store encrypted information to avoid the stored data in them being

vulnerable to malicious attacks by third parties.

 

ACCORDING TO THE PROPERTY

Own cookies: are sent to the user’s terminal team from a team or power managed by the own

editor and from where the requested service is provided by the user.

 

Third party cookies: are sent to the user’s terminal team from a team or power which is not

managed by the editor, but by another body which processes data obtained through the

cookies.

 

DEPENDING ON THE STORAGE PERIOD

Session cookies: are a type of cookie designed to collect and store data as long as the user

accesses a website.

 

Permanent cookies: are a type of cookies where data continues to be stored in the terminal

and may be accessed and processed for a period of time defined by the cookie controller, and

that can range from a few minutes to several years.

HOW TO MANAGE COOKIES FROM YOUR BROWSER

Delete cookies from your device

Cookies that are already on a device can be deleted by clearing the browser history, thus deleting the cookies from all websites visited.

However, some of the saved information (e.g. login data or website preferences) may also be lost.

Manage site specificcookies

For more precise control of site specific cookies, users can adjust their privacy settings and cookies in their browser.

Blocking cookies

While most modern browsers can be configured to prevent cookies from being installed on a device, this may require the manual adjustment of certain preferences each time a site or page is visited. In addition, some services and features may not work properly (for example, profile logins).
